Why honest essays get flagged

Detectors score how predictable your writing is. Careful student writing — even sentences, formal vocabulary, textbook structure — shares that surface with machine text. It is a known bias, not something you did wrong; non-native writers are hit hardest (why ESL gets flagged).

A score is never proof. Every result here shows the specific patterns behind it, so a number turns into something you can actually check — and fix.

Why does my own writing score high?

Formal, careful writing — especially from non-native English speakers — shares surface habits with AI text: even sentences, formal vocabulary, few contractions. That's exactly why we show the reasons, not just a number, and why no score should ever be treated as proof.

What should I do if I'm accused of using AI?

Stay calm and bring evidence: your draft history, notes, and a ScanForAI report showing the per-line breakdown. Ask what tool was used and its known false-positive behavior. A single detector score is not proof, and most institutions know it.

Can universities detect AI writing?

Most run something — Turnitin's AI indicator or a standalone detector — and every one of them has documented false positives. That's the practical reason to check your own work first and keep your drafts: you want evidence on your side before anyone else runs a tool.
